Overview

Immerse yourself in the world of performance with the theatre track of our performing arts degree. Develop your intellectual and creative potential through a mix of professional theatre training, performance skills, and classic liberal arts knowledge. Benefit from the seasoned scholars, performers, writers, and directors who make up the faculty, and the diverse performing arts scene of Washington, DC.

Work Permit USA

Optional Practical Training or OPT is a period during which students, who have completed their degrees in the USA, are permitted to work for one year on a student visa by the United States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S). OPT allows students to work for up to 3 years and develop real-world skills to survive in the competitive jobs market.

It is temporary employment for a period of 12-months that is directly related to the major area of study of an F-1 student. Eligible students have the option to apply for OPT employment authorization before completing their academic studies and/or after completing their academic studies.

A student can participate in three types of Optional Practical Training (OPT):

  1. Pre-Completion OPT: This is temporary employment provided to F-1 students before completion of their course of study.
  2. Post-Completion OPT: This is temporary employment available to F-1 students after completing their course of study.
  3. 24 Month STEM Extension: Students enrolled in STEM (Science, Technology, Engineering, and Mathematics) courses can a 24-month extension after their initial Post-Completion OPT authorization.

Issues of identity, whether avowed or ascribed and socially constructed or naturally derived, fundamentally shape people's lives and society. In particular, race, gender, class, religion, sexual orientation, and nationality are determinate identities for many, though in reality, everyone holds multiple identities at the same time. Although these identities often appear to be static and fixed from the outside, they are dynamic and ever-changing, driven by the broader cultural and social influences in which they arise and exist. Courses in this Thematic Area examine the nature of these identities in a world in transition. Our courses, embodying both theoretical and grounded approaches, explore each of these identities in their own right, as well as in a historical and an intersectional manner that explores the relationship between them.

The MA in Art History provides advanced historical study in European and American art from the early Renaissance through the present, as well as Asian and other non-Western art, to prepare you for a doctoral program, curatorial position, or one of many other museum-related careers. You will develop an understanding of art historical methods and research practices while building skills in critical thinking, visual analysis, research, and written and verbal communication about art. Our program exposes students to innovative approaches to art history to foster a broad understanding of the discipline and its wide-ranging applications.
